Transaction ac48c95e13b01057862cdf5ffa496b23eb85dc288b3f5fb69b866aaff461571e

2 Input
2 Outputs
  • ac48c95e13b01057862cdf5ffa496b23eb85dc288b3f5fb69b866aaff461571e:0
  • value  18909043
    address  3BCsUD9BfWQ8Ph5KyaaQybBVxXPFiYpHWj
  • ac48c95e13b01057862cdf5ffa496b23eb85dc288b3f5fb69b866aaff461571e:1
  • value  102000000
    address  1HcUXK4tRUQjjb9Y7HDvUELfU61gxBSm2S